Rumored Buzz on i store dubai
Absolutely! "The Petshop" stores are pet-helpful and welcome your furry companions. Our easy locations ensure it is easy to deliver your dog along for your entertaining and enjoyable shopping working experience.Seeking quality services and products for your personal furry pals? Use our store locator to locate the nearest "The Petshop" store, in whi